Sigma Computing’s Go-To-Market (GTM) architecture forms the backbone of how the company brings products to market and drives revenue. The Director of Go-To-Market Architecture leads the technical design and integration of this landscape, ensuring data accuracy and system reliability across every stage of the GTM process. This position reports to the VP of Revenue Operations. The role calls for a leader who sees the GTM tech stack as a platform for growth, not just a collection of tools. The Director shapes the architectural strategy, translating vision into scalable systems, integrations, and automation that support Sigma’s revenue goals. Key Responsibilities GTM System Architecture Design and oversee the architecture of the GTM stack, including platforms such as Sigma, Salesforce, Clay, Outreach, LeanData, Zoominfo, and others. Ensure these systems remain adaptable, resilient, and aligned with revenue priorities. Develop signal-based lead and account routing, territory management, and opportunity orchestration. Make sure the right signals reach the right team members at the right time. Partner with Data Engineering to create internal, Sigma-driven alternatives to legacy SaaS tools. Migrate workflows to the data warehouse to improve flexibility and manage costs. This 'SaaS Takeout' initiative aims to replace point solutions with warehouse-native processes. Salesforce and Enrichment Platform Strategy Oversee the Salesforce instance as a strategic asset. Design custom objects, flows, and integrations that can scale with the business. Lead the development of advanced outbound and enrichment workflows using Clay. Build multi-source data waterfalls that give Sales Development Representatives (SDRs) and Account Executives (AEs) a measurable advantage. Regularly evaluate and improve enrichment and orchestration tools as the market evolves, ensuring Sigma uses top-tier capabilities and avoids vendor lock-in. The 'Sigma on Sigma' Vision Act as the in-house expert on using Sigma to power the company’s own GTM strategy. This includes building live dashboards to replace static reporting and demonstrating the platform’s value internally.
